James Adams, Jr. Obituary

James H. (Jay) Adams Jr. of Leland, NC passed away from his earthly life into his eternal life to be with his Lord and Savior Jesus on May 21, 2023. He was born in Wilmington on June 1, 1947 to his parents, the late James and Virginia Batten Adams and graduated high school from NHHS in 1965, and then served in the U.S. Navy.

Jay loved baseball, was a NY Yankees fan and in football he always pulled for the Washington Redskins. He and his good friend, the late Pete Freeman, also coached T-ball and Little League for many years in Leland.

By the grace of God, Jay was saved in 1986 and God used him in many different ministries including mission trips to Poland to build churches.

Jay loved missions and would tell anyone that if God called them to go into the mission field, they should always keep their bags packed. Jay was a long-time member of Long Leaf Baptist and loved teaching and studying his Bible. He and his friend Danny Avant would always talk and share Gods word daily for many years.

Jay was employed with Freeman Concrete of Rocky Point until he retired and the family wishes to say a very special thanks to Mike Freeman, Juanita Freeman, John Herring, Bryan Southerland and the many crews he worked with over the years.
